Flower One Holdings Debt-to-EBITDA Calculation

Debt-to-EBITDA measures a company's ability to pay off its debt.

Flower One Holdings's Debt-to-EBITDA for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2021 is calculated as

Debt-to-EBITDA=Total Debt / EBITDA
=(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ation +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ation) / EBITDA
=(10.295 + 68.873) / 4.255
=18.61

Flower One Holdings's annualized Debt-to-EBITDA for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2022 is calculated as

Debt-to-EBITDA=Total Debt / EBITDA
=(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ation +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ation) / EBITDA
=(7.258 + 92.251) / 3.7
=26.89

In the calculation of annual Debt-to-EBITDA, the EBITDA of the last fiscal year is used. In calculating the annualized quarterly data, the EBITDA data used here is four times the quarterly (Jun. 2022) EBITDA data.


Flower One Holdings  (FRA:F11) Debt-to-EBITDA Explanation

In the calculation of Debt-to-EBITDA, we use the total of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ation and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ation divided by EBITDA. In some calculations, Total Liabilities is used to for calculation.


Be Aware

A high Debt-to-EBITDA ratio generally means that a company may spend more time to paying off its debt.

According to Joel Tillinghast's BIG MONEY THINKS SMALL: Biases, Blind Spots, and Smarter Investing, a ratio of Debt-to-EBITDA exceeding four is usually considered scary unless tangible assets cover the debt.

Flower One Holdings Inc through its wholly?owned subsidiaries, is a cannabis cultivator and producer and is licensed for medical and recreational cannabis cultivation and production in the State of Nevada. Its properties will be used for cannabis cultivation as well as the processing, production, and high-volume packaging of dry flower, cannabis oils, concentrates, and infused products. It produces a wide range of products from flower, full-spectrum oils, and distillates to finished consumer packaged goods, including a variety of: pre-rolls, concentrates, edibles, topicals, and more for the top-performing brands in cannabis.
